What are the three parts of the atom?

Answer: Protons, Neutrons, Electrons

11stst Category Name– for $200 Category Name– for $200

What is the center of the atom called?

Answer: Nucleous

11stst Category Name– for $300 Category Name– for $300

What parts are found in the center of the atom?

Answer: Protons, Neutrons

11stst Category Name– for $400 Category Name– for $400

What parts orbit the outside of the atom?

Answer: Electrons

22ndnd Category – for $100 Category – for $100

How can you tell how many protons are in an atom?

Answer: The atomic number
